I only know of one reason to choose the .243 AR10 platform over the AR15.243WSSM version and that is higher quality brass in .243Win.

Other than that...the WSSM .243 will do everything the AR10 will do in a smaller package. that being said. if you dont reload, and want more of a bullet choice...go with the AR10. Originally Posted By: MrgunslingerWhy do you say the 243 brass is higher quality?

because no "quality" brass makers are doing WSSM brass yet. with the 243Win you have the option of using brass from a company like Lake City, Norma, Lapua etc.
With the WSSM your basically limited to Winchester and Federal and it isnt very consistent.

for your average lead slinger (like me)...no big deal. but some of the guys on WSSMzone that are BIG TIME WSSM reloaders HATE begin stuck using mediocre brass.
